Otterbox Defender case without glass

Hello, is it possible to mount Otterbox Defender case to iPad but without that part of protective glass/the front of the case? Because I would like to put Paperlike on the screen.

The OtterBox Defender cases have a built-in plastic screen protector that is incorporated within the case design. While you might consider cutting away the plastic screen protector before fitting the iPad, you will at best void your case warranty.


You might better consider an alternative rugged case - that doesn’t include a built-in screen protector. The OtterBox Symmetry Symmetry Series 360 have good reputation. STM Dux are also well regarded.
